Released in 2014, Farewell to the Moon is a drama film directed by Dick Tuinder, running about 94 minutes. “1972. The last man on the moon. A boys' first love affair.” — that tagline sets the tone.
What it’s about. It's the hot summer of 1972: the Americans launch their last mission to the moon; also a time of dungarees and hallucinogenic wallpaper. On the eighth floor of a new Dutch apartment block, 12-year-old Duch lives with his family. His hobbies are space travel and Mary, the pretty woman next door. Duch’s father prefers to watch the neighbour who recently moved in two doors down. Her arrival makes the residents aware of the free-sex morality. Up until now it had left the eighth floor untouched, but that is clearly not to everyone’s satisfaction.
Who’s in it. Farewell to the Moon stars Marcel Hensema as Bob and Elise Schaap as Mary.
